The disciples’ minds immediately went to bread when Jesus spoke of leaven. They were so consumed with temporal concerns that they missed the spiritual warning. Jesus gently redirected them: “Set your mind on things above.” This remains our constant battle. Bills, health concerns, relationship struggles, career decisions—these material realities demand attention. Yet Jesus calls us to elevate our perspective. He doesn’t dismiss our earthly needs; He promises to provide them as we prioritize His kingdom.
So, what about that financial pressure? That difficult conversation? Jesus isn’t asking you to ignore reality but to view it through an eternal lens. You already have Jesus—and He is enough. When worry rises, acknowledge it, then consciously choose to focus on God’s character, His promises, and His presence with you right now.
